From: Loren J. Rittle Date: Sat, 3 May 2003 07:42:22 +0000 (+0000) Subject: * testsuite/thread/pthread1.cc: Remove special case for FreeBSD. X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=d4c67b6ee3f0b8b3da21a2233397512805d93264;p=gcc.git * testsuite/thread/pthread1.cc: Remove special case for FreeBSD. From-SVN: r66418 --- diff --git a/libstdc++-v3/ChangeLog b/libstdc++-v3/ChangeLog index d47f26dad70..df4bcfc8ae6 100644 --- a/libstdc++-v3/ChangeLog +++ b/libstdc++-v3/ChangeLog @@ -1,3 +1,7 @@ +2003-05-03 Loren J. Rittle + + * testsuite/thread/pthread1.cc: Remove special case for FreeBSD. + 2003-05-02 Benjamin Kosnik * include/Makefile.am (CLEANFILES): Remove PCH files in target diff --git a/libstdc++-v3/testsuite/thread/pthread1.cc b/libstdc++-v3/testsuite/thread/pthread1.cc index a6af93fbe9a..2ea52ca975a 100644 --- a/libstdc++-v3/testsuite/thread/pthread1.cc +++ b/libstdc++-v3/testsuite/thread/pthread1.cc @@ -124,14 +124,6 @@ main (int argc, char** argv) { pthread_join (prod[i], NULL); pthread_join (cons[i], NULL); -#if defined(__FreeBSD__) && __FreeBSD__ < 5 - // These lines are not required by POSIX since a successful - // join is suppose to detach as well... - pthread_detach (prod[i]); - pthread_detach (cons[i]); - // ...but they are according to the FreeBSD 4.X code base - // or else you get a memory leak. -#endif delete tq[i]; } }